Как мне установить classpath и путь для запуска сервлетов в Ubuntu 18.04 " - PullRequest
0 голосов
/ 16 июня 2019

Я часами пробовал что-то в Интернете, чтобы запустить мои сервлеты.но это невозможно.

   nsword@nsword:~/ref$ javac Login.java
Login.java:5: error: cannot find symbol
public class Login extends HttpServlet {
                           ^
  symbol: class HttpServlet
Login.java:7: error: cannot find symbol
protected void doPost(HttpServletRequest request, HttpServletResponse response)
                      ^
  symbol:   class HttpServletRequest
  location: class Login
Login.java:7: error: cannot find symbol
protected void doPost(HttpServletRequest request, HttpServletResponse response)
                                                  ^
  symbol:   class HttpServletResponse
  location: class Login
Login.java:8: error: cannot find symbol
throws ServletException, IOException
       ^
  symbol:   class ServletException
  location: class Login
Login.java:2: error: package javax does not exist
import javax.*;
^
Login.java:3: error: package javax.servlet.http does not exist
import javax.servlet.http.*;
^
Login.java:15: error: cannot find symbol
RequestDispatcher rs = request.getRequestDispatcher("Welcome");
^
  symbol:   class RequestDispatcher
  location: class Login
Login.java:21: error: cannot find symbol
RequestDispatcher rs = request.getRequestDispatcher("index.html");
^
  symbol:   class RequestDispatcher
  location: class Login
8 errors

он даже не компилируется.показывает 8 ошибок, я думаю, что не могу найти пакет javax.servlet. Позже мне нужно запустить это на tomcat.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...